MetaTrader 4 also known as MT4 is one of the top trading platforms on the planet and has been in active use on financial markets since 2005. The MetaTrader 4 software delivers a feature-rich, user-friendly interface and an extremely customisable trading environment, designed to cover all your trading needs and boost your trading performance. Charting functionality and advanced order management tools make certain you could monitor your positions quickly and economically.
The MetaTrader 4 (MT4) trading platform was developed primarily to trade Forex but you can also trade other types of financial instruments through CFDs and Spread Betting. You will not be able to trade Stocks, Indices, Commodities, ETFs, Futures on any MetaTrader 4 (MT4) platform unless they are CFD contracts or Spread bets. You will not own any underlying assets with CFDs or Spread bets as you are speculating on price movements.

Commission And Fees Explained
eToro is an online broker platform, and many online brokerages charge lower fees than traditional brokerages tend to bill. The reason for this is that the companies of online brokerages are scaled much better. In other words, an internet broker is not necessarily influenced by the amount of clients they have.
But this does not mean that online brokers don't charge any fees. They charge fees of varying rates for a variety of services to make money. There are primarily 3 types of fees for this purpose.
The first sort of charges to look out for are trading fees. When you make a genuine trade, like purchasing a stock or an ETF, you're billed trading charges. In such instances, you're spending a spread, funding speed, or even a commission. The kinds of trading fees and the rates vary from broker to broker.
Commissions can be fixed or determined by the traded volume. On the other hand, a spread denotes the gap between the buying and selling price. Financing or overnight rates are those who are charged when you hold a leveraged position for more than daily.
Apart from trading charges, online brokers also charge non-trading fees. These are determined by the actions you undertake in your accounts. They are billed for things like depositing cash, not trading for long periods, or withdrawals.

Why does eToro ask for my passport?
The reason that eToro asks for your passport when you open a live account is to ensure that it remains within the rules of its regulated bodies. Because there is a lot of money moving around the world, eToro has to be careful that they don't breach any money laundering laws and part of that is know as KYC (Know your customer). This means that at all times, eToro must know exactly who they are dealing with so that if there is any investigation they are comfortable that they are well within the law.

Skrill (formerly Moneybookers) is a digital wallet company that was founded in 2001. It offers a variety of online payment and money transfer services.
Since its inception, Skrill has expanded to operate in more than 120 countries, with its digital wallet available in 40 different currencies. Customers can deposit money into their Skrill wallet by using a variety of payment options , including bank transfer, card, and several alternative payment options. The funds can then be used to pay merchants, others Skrill customers, or converted into cryptocurrency.
Skrill also provides cross-border payment through its remittance service Skrill Money Transfer. The service enables customers to transfer funds to an account at a bank overseas by using their credit card. The service was acquired in 2015 by the Paysafe Group. Skrill was acquired by the Paysafe Group along with former competitor Neteller and prepaid payment service paysafecard.
Skrill holds a number of licences that permit it to provide its services throughout Europe and around the world. Skrill is operated through Paysafe Payment Solutions Limited, a company incorporated in Ireland and regulated by the Central Bank of Ireland, for its European regulated activities. Skrill's operations outside of Europe are managed by European Economic Area are operated by Skrill Limited - a company which is incorporated within the United Kingdom and reg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ority.

Payoneer, an American financial services company, offers online money transfer and digital payment services. It also provides working capital to customers.
Account holders can send or receive funds via an ewallet, virtual bank account number in local currency, or a reloadable prepaid MasterCard debitcard. The Payoneer debit card allows money to be used online or at point-of-sale with the Payoneer debit cards. This company is a specialist in cross-border B2B transactions. It provides cross-border transactions in 200 countries and territories and more than 150 local currencies, with its cross border wire transfers, online payments, and refillable debit card services.
Payoneer is used by companies like Airbnb, Google, Amazon and Upwork to send large-scale payouts all over the globe. It is also used by eCommerce marketplaces such as Rakuten, Walmart and Wish.com, freelance marketplaces such as Fiverr and Envato, and works with ad networks to connect these firms with publishers based outside of their headquartered country.
In the content creation space, Payoneer works with Getty Images, iStock, Pond5, and others as well as in the freelance marketplace.
Payoneer has a customer care team with 320 employees who support 4 million customers in 70 languages, operating in 150 different currencies.
In October 2019, the company launched a service aimed for small and medium-sized businesses to send payments anywhere in the world quickly and cheaply.
